Question:
Got a trailstar trailer with a titan model 60 on it bout 19 years old. Cap wont come off to check fluid. Brakes locked up briefly a few times when back up. Whats causing that how do I fix it
asked by: Eric
Expert Reply:
The issue is that with the way a surge coupler works when backing up, normally up hill, the trailer is pushing the other way which will cause the actuator to compress in sending fluid back to engage the brakes. This makes it very difficult or impossible sometimes to back the trailer up.
Your Titan Model 60 actuator would need to have a lockout solenoid installed on it so that it could back up. For that you'd need the Titan solenoid part # T4748800 and you'd be able to back the traler up. I attached an install video for this for you to check out too.
